📖 𝚂𝚈𝙽𝙾𝙿𝚂𝙸𝚂:
Claire Winesett never expected to be sleeping on her best friend’s brother’s couch. But the last nine years as a solo-travel influencer has been anything but predictable. Luckily, Claire thrives on spontaneity, and after all, it’s only temporary.
Boundaries define every aspect of Rowan Bellamy’s life, and having his teenage crush under his roof is disrupting his routines. Especially now that Claire seems to be seeing him as more than the boy she left behind—the chemistry between them sizzling hotter than the Arizonan summer.
When a trip to the ER leads Claire on a path to crushing medical debt, Rowan shocks her with an unexpected proposal. But Claire can’t accept a paper-only marriage to gain Rowan’s health insurance without offering something in return—a Fun Pact. Two nights a week, they add a little variety to Rowan’s measured life.
Old West bar fights, silent desert discos, and improv lessons aren’t Rowan’s idea of fun, but he’ll do anything to hear Claire’s snort laugh. The problem is the more time they spend together, the harder it is for Rowan to subdue the possessive impulse to kiss his wife.
💭 𝚃𝙷𝙾𝚄𝙶𝙷𝚃𝚂:
Thank you so much Laura for my copy of An Unexpected Roomie, and Happy Pub Day! I enjoyed Rowan and Claire’s story so much, and fell in love with Rowan hard and fast! He was my favorite part of the story and instantly made it onto my book boyfriend list 💕 The chemistry that these two had was off the charts, and the slow-burn sweet romance was fantastic! I loved Claire and Meg’s relationship too, it reminded me of the friends I have in my life that are most important. The conflict in the book, I feel, came to a conclusion a little suddenly, but I was really happy with how everything ended!
